Gift Aid

If you pay tax in the UK, then Gift Aid is a simple way to increase the value of your donations to Headway Cambridgeshire.

Making your donation using Gift Aid enables Headway Cambridgeshire to reclaim the basic rate tax on your gift.

Basic rate tax is 20 per cent, so this means that if you give £10 using Gift Aid, it’s worth £12.50 to Headway Cambridgeshire.
